Android结束通话并进入主屏幕
我试着制作一个安卓程序,在这个程序中,我可以通过点击按钮拨打一个号码。工作正常,但当我结束调用时,模拟器显示调用日志。与此相反,我希望我的程序返回到屏幕,屏幕上是我所做的调用按钮。我该怎么做?我的代码现在是这样的Android结束通话并进入主屏幕,android,Android,我试着制作一个安卓程序,在这个程序中,我可以通过点击按钮拨打一个号码。工作正常,但当我结束调用时,模拟器显示调用日志。与此相反,我希望我的程序返回到屏幕,屏幕上是我所做的调用按钮。我该怎么做?我的代码现在是这样的 ((Button) findViewById(R.id.soita)).setOnClickListener( new Button.OnClickListener() { @Override public void onClic
((Button) findViewById(R.id.soita)).setOnClickListener(
new Button.OnClickListener() {
@Override public void onClick(View arg0) {
String nro="9999999";
Intent intent1 = new Intent(Intent.ACTION_CALL,Uri.parse("tel:"+nro));
startActivity(intent1);
Intent intent2 = new Intent(Intent.CATEGORY_HOME);
startActivity(intent2);
试一试
Intent homeIntent = new Intent(Intent.ACTION_MAIN);
homeIntent.addCategory(Intent.CATEGORY_HOME);
homeIntent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
我发现,当我在一个按钮中结束调用时,活动管理器显示开始活动:Intent{action=android.Intent.action.VIEW type=vnd.anroid.cursor.dir/calls comp={com.andoid,然后我在Eclipse中看不到行的其余部分。我可以改变这个意图吗?